我瞭解Hive用於安全的角色的概念。是否可以通過Hive QL使用類似DISPLAY ROLES
的語句來查找此信息?是否可以通過Hive QL獲取角色信息?
獎勵:是否可以通過Hive QL獲取Hadoop用戶信息?
我瞭解Hive用於安全的角色的概念。是否可以通過Hive QL使用類似DISPLAY ROLES
的語句來查找此信息?是否可以通過Hive QL獲取角色信息?
獎勵:是否可以通過Hive QL獲取Hadoop用戶信息?
查看角色:
SHOW ROLE GRANT principal_specification
查看的privilages:
SHOW GRANT principal_specification
[ON object_type priv_level [(column_list)]]
其中:
principal_specification
: USER user
| GROUP group
| ROLE role
欲瞭解更多詳細看here
'執行錯誤,從org.apache.hadoop.hive.ql.exec.DDLTask返回代碼1。 getAllRoles()未在Ranger HiveAuthorizer中實現 –
它看起來像我需要知道什麼角色存在才能使用此方法。你知道一個顯示所有角色的查詢嗎? – bheussler
如果您沒有將角色授予任何人,那麼我不知道如何查看角色。但是,如果您確實授予了此權限,請使用'show role grant user USERNAME' – dimamah